.Dd October 12, 1987 .Dt NEWKEY 8 .Os .Sh NAME .Nm newkey .Nd create a new key in the publickey database .Sh SYNOPSIS .Nm .Fl h Ar hostname .Nm .Fl u Ar username .Sh DESCRIPTION The .Nm utility is normally run by the network administrator on the Network Interface Service

q NIS master machine in order to establish public keys for users and super-users on the network. These keys are needed for using secure RPC or secure NFS .

p The .Nm utility will prompt for the login password of the given username and then create a new public/secret key pair in

a /etc/publickey encrypted with the login password of the given user.

p Use of this program is not required: users may create their own keys using .Xr chkey 1 . .Sh OPTIONS l -tag -width indent t Fl h Ar hostname Create a new public key for the super-user at the given hostname. Prompts for the root password of the given hostname. t Fl u Ar username Create a new public key for the given username.
